Millions of Cubans were left without electricity after the country’s national power grid suddenly collapsed, triggering a nationwide blackout. Authorities are investigating the cause while emergency teams work to restore supply. The outage has further deepened Cuba’s ongoing energy crisis, already strained by ageing infrastructure and fuel shortages.
